内容説明
ISDN (Integrated Services Digital Network) is a forward-looking telecommunication network that accommodates both present and future information movement needs. The goal of ISDN is to have one common network to move all types of information (text, music, images, video, fax). The author discusses just how important this technology is, and how it will affect the future of telecommunications. His book gives a broad, even treatment of the perspectives necessary to understand ISDN. It includes a technical overview, a historical evolutionary view, and discusses the legal issues and regulations involved.
